I went today and took my 13 year old daughter Julia to her first con. I think she got a kick out of seeing dad interacting with the other grownup fanboys. Had a nice chat with Vincent from Metropolis.....first time we've actually spoken in person. Very helpful looking over some books I brought along.

 

Made my usual purchase from Blazing Bob (see Have a Cigar thread).....I keep going to these and coming home with cgc purchases from Bob only. He always has the goods and runs a tight little ship there. Very organized, very pro. No schmoozing. All business, well mostly.

 

Had a nice lunch with Foolkiller, Capt. Tripps and Dam60. I showed them my "trio of tears" books, three great books I got in the early 80's that are mid to hi grade, except that the long gone dealer had trimmed off a piece of the top of the front cover of each. Just the front cover, not the pages. Must have been a neat freak. In 1981 I never noticed it. Not to much awareness about restoration in those days. The books? FF 9, FF48 and ASM 14. Argghh!

 

The con was only one day this time......seemed a bit less crowded. Rene whatisname from Deep Space Nine was sitting alone, and looking a little melancholy so I went over and talked to him for a bit.

 

Ayers along with Mrs. A were there as always. DAM60 was working the ACTOR table hard and from last report they had a pretty good amount of donations.

 

Met Ghost_town for the first time today too. So was having a chat with him and Captain Tripps, the #1 and #2 Avengers registry set guys. Me, the lowly #6 set. If that's your thing. Interesting.

 

Scott and the crew from CGC were busy taking submissions.

 

Nothing super exciting this time around, just happy to hang out with a couple of friends from the boards and my daughter, who actually admitted to having "a pretty good time", even though she is not into comics.
